Chrome for Android introduced the requirement for java files.
Android's style guide:
http://source.android.com/source/code-style.html#limit-line-length
defines 100 columns for .java files.
This patch changes the presubmit tests which are also used by chromium's CQ.

The presubmit check complained about long lines in .grd files. This isn't a useful warning since .grd files aren't really source files.
The problem was that callers were passing in a file filter to InputApi.AffectedFiles but it was being ignored. Fix was to use the passed in file filter.
